Own a Piece of Rush History - Neil Peart's Red Tama Drum Kit Auction

Neil Peart's TAMA Drum Kit
Back in 1987, Neil Peart, alongside Modern Drummer Magazine, sponsored an essay contest where one lucky winner would receive Peart's custom Red Tama Drum Kit; the very same used to record Signals, Grace Under Pressure and Power Windows. Neil also used the kit during the Grace Under Pressure tour.

The very same kit is now up for auction at Julien's Live Auction site. From the listing:
A Tama Superstar drum kit, custom made for Neil Peart, drummer from the band Rush. The kit was used by Peart for recording on three Rush albums, Signals (Anthem, 1982), Grace Under Pressure (Anthem, 1984), and Power Windows (Anthem, 1985), as well as all live shows played on the concert tours that followed the release of each album. Peart also played the kit in nine music videos for the singles that were released from each album. As well, Peart can be seen playing the kit in the RUSH concert video "Grace Under Pressure Tour 1984" (Anthem, 1985) which was recorded live at Maple Leaf Gardens in Toronto, Canada, on September 21, 1984. The kit was originally given away by Peart to the winner of a contest that was held in Modern Drummer magazine in 1987.
